A thrilling page-turner of epic proportions, Tom Reiss?s panoramic bestseller tells the true story of a Jew who transformed himself into a Muslim prince in Nazi Germany. Lev Nussimbaum escaped the Russian Revolution in a camel caravan and, as ?Essad Bey,? became a celebrated author with the enduring novel Ali and Nino as well as an adventurer, a real-life Indiana Jones with a fatal secret. Reiss pursued Lev?s story across ten countries and found himself caught up in encounters as dramatic and surreal?and sometimes as heartbreaking?as his subject?s life.
